SDI-12 Interface

The SDI-12 interface is another way to setup and operate the H-3553. The H-3553 supports all standard
SDI-12 commands and uses some SDI-12 extended (manufacturer specific) commands for setup operation.
SDI-12 standard and extended commands are normally sent from a SDI-12 master device, like the Waterlog
XL series DCP. Table 4-2 is a list of the standard SDI-12 commands and the extended SDI-12 commands for
setting up the H-3553.

Command

Description

Command

Description

Standard SDI-12 Commands

a!

Acknowledge

aM2!

Initiate Purge

al!

Identify

aC!-aC9!

Concurrent Measure

aV!

Verify

aCC!-aCC9!

Concurrent measure w/CRC

aM!-aM1!

Measure

aD0!-aD9!

Data Retrieval

aMC!-MC1!

Measure with CRC

aAn!

Change Address

Extended SDI-12 Commands

aXSDEF!

Reset to Defaults

aXRPP!

Read Purge Pressure

aXWSn.nn!

Write Stage Slope

aXWPSnn!

Write Purge Sustain

aXRS!

Read Stage Slope

aXRPS!

Read Purge Sustain

aXSCSn.nn!

Set Current Stage

aXWIHn.nn!

Write 4-20mA Stage max

aXWOn.nn!

Write Stage Offset

aXRIH!

Read 4-20mA Stage Max

aXRO!

Read Stage Offset

aXWILn.nn!

Write 4-20mA Stage Min

aXWATnn!

Write Averaging Time

aXRIL!

Read 4-20mA Stage Min

aXRAT!

Read Averaging Time

aXWMEn!

Write Modbus enable

aXWSDn!

Write RS-232 Stage Digits

aXRMEn!

Read Modbus enable

aXRSD!

Read RS-232 Stage Digits

aXWAEn!

Write Auto enable

aXWBRnn!

Write Bubble Rate

aXRAEn!

Read Auto enable

aXRBR!

Read Bubble Rate

aXWMRnn!

Write Measure Rate

aXWPPnn!

Write Purge Pressure

aXRMR!

Read Measure Rate

aXTD!

Test Display

aXHELP!

Display a List of Commands

Table 4-2: H-3553 Standard and Extended SDI-12 Commands

Note, the ‘a’ character in Table 4-2 represents the current SDI-12 address of the H-3553 and the ‘n’ characters
represent the new value to be written. Each H-3553 extended SDI-12 command is discussed in more detail
later in the chapter.
